Where is the Pount family from?

You can see how Pount families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Pount family name was found in the UK, and Canada between 1891 and 1911. The most Pount families were found in Canada in 1911. In 1911 there were 11 Pount families living in Quebec. This was 100% of all the recorded Pount's in Canada. Quebec had the highest population of Pount families in 1911.
